How much do assistant store manager of operations j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for assistant store manager of operations in Portland, OR is $20.09,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.30 and $22.93 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an assistant store manager of operations do?

An Assistant Store Manager of Operations is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of a retail store, ensuring that processes run smoothly and efficiently. They supervise staff, handle inventory management, maintain store standards, and assist in meeting sales goals. Additionally, they help implement company policies, resolve customer issues, and work closely with the Store Manager to optimize business performance. This role often requires strong leadership, problem-solving skills, and the 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ant store manager of operations?

To thrive as an Assistant Store Manager of Operations, you need strong leadership, organizational, and retail management skills, often supported by a background in retail or business administration. Familiarity with inventory management systems, point-of-sale (POS) software, scheduling tools, and sometimes certifications in retail management are typ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and customer service skills help you motivate teams and handle challenging situations. These skills ensure efficient store operations, high customer satisfaction, and achievement of sales and operational goals.

What are some common challenges faced by an assistant store manager of operations, and how can they be effectively addressed?

Assistant Store Managers of Operations often encounter challenges such as balancing administrative tasks with on-the-floor leadership, ensuring staff adherence to company policies, and maintaining high operational standards during busy periods. Successfully managing these challenges involves strong organizational skills, prioritizing clear communication with the team, and staying adaptable to changing store demands. Building strong relationships with both staff and upper management also helps streamline operations and foster a collaborative work environment.

What is the difference between Assistant Store Manager Of Operations vs Assistant Store Manager?

AspectAssistant Store Manager Of OperationsAssistant Store Manager
ResponsibilitiesOversees store operations, implements policies, manages staff performance, and supports sales goals.Focuses on daily store management, customer service, and sales targets.
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; experience in retail management; leadership skills.High school diploma or equivalent; retail experience; customer service skills.
Work EnvironmentRetail stores, often with additional operational duties and team oversight.

The Assistant Store Manager Of Operations typically has broader responsibilities related to store operations and management strategies, while the Assistant Store Manager focuses more on daily store activities and customer interactions. Both roles require retail experience and leadership skills, but the Operations role involves a higher level of oversight and strategic planning.
